On Sat, 2003-08-16 at 18:01, Gene Heskett wrote:
> Damn, grep must not look at .files, its there, and still 14. Thanks a > bunch, new build underway. > > However, I'd assume a make mrproper, or an oldconfig might reset that > to the include/config/log/buf/shift.h value? Its also in > autoconfig.h FWTW.
"make mrproper" will destroy your ".config" file. And, AFAIK, "make oldconfig" will only create CONFIG_LOG_BUF_SHIFT if it doesn't exist so, if your ".config" does hold a concrete value, it will be kept even when you run "make oldconfig".
